Living in dependence on the Lord is exciting! Most of us hurry around trying to accomplish our plans through our own strength and ability. Some succeed fabulously while others fail miserably.

Whether we fail or succeed in our dreams, we have missed out if we are not living  and working in a relationship with our God who has the power to change lives that we humans lack. 

When we depend on the Christ, our whole perspective changes for the good. We see miracles happening all around us instead of coincidences. We know that the Lord's plans are much better than our plans for our lives. We must choose to live, move, and have our being in Christ.  This is the ultimate plan He offers us when we believe! Adapted from "Jesus Calling" by Sarah Young.
